Understanding the 3266 Trimming Potentiometer
Before we discuss its applicability in CCTV cameras, let's first understand what the 3266 Trimming Potentiometer is. A potentiometer is a three - terminal resistor with a sliding or rotating contact that forms an adjustable voltage divider. The 3266 Trimming Potentiometer is a multiturn trimming potentiometer, which means it allows for fine - adjustment of resistance values. Requirements of CCTV Cameras
CCTV cameras are complex electronic devices that require precise control of various electrical parameters to function optimally. Some of the key requirements include:
Image Quality
To capture clear and sharp images, CCTV cameras need to control the brightness, contrast, and color balance accurately. This often involves adjusting the gain and offset of the image sensor, which requires precise control of electrical signals. A small deviation in the electrical parameters can lead to a significant degradation in image quality.
Signal Processing
CCTV cameras also need to process the captured video signals efficiently. This includes tasks such as analog - to - digital conversion, noise reduction, and compression. Precise control of the electrical signals during the signal processing stage is crucial to ensure that the final video output is of high quality.
Power Management
Efficient power management is essential for CCTV cameras, especially those that are installed in remote or hard - to - access locations. CCTV cameras need to operate within a specific power range to ensure stable performance and to avoid overheating. This requires the ability to adjust the power supply voltage and current accurately.
